Barbieux park
The park Barbieux is located on the commune of Roubaix in the Northern (59) of the France. It is a remarkable park by the presence of many gasolines of trees. It extends on 1,5 kilometers with a surface from 34 hectares.
Geography
The Barbieux park is located at the Western end of the town of Roubaix, along the grand boulevard which connects the center of Roubaix to the center of Lille. The Barbieux park separates in two parts the town of Croix. The neighborhoods of the Barbieux park constitute the richest zone of the town of Roubaix, with many luxeuses houses.
History
In the years 1840, a project to dig a channel starting from Roubaix to connect the Marque had been started. But various technical difficulties lead to its abandonment. In 1859, Henri-Leon Lisot imagines to replace these grounds undulating and this beginning of channel by a city park. Work begins in 1879 and will finish officially in 1905 by order of the prefect.In 1919, the part of the Barbieux park located on the territory of the town of Cross is yielded to the town of Roubaix, which will cause quasi-separation into two of the town of Cross.
Leisures
The barbieux park is an important place of the leisures roubaisiens. The park proposes, in addition to the walks, the grounds of game of bowls, the plays for children and a horse-gear, a miniature golf, pedal boats and boats as well as a restaurant-bar and various refreshment bars.The barbieux park is also the place where a very great number of couples have just married come to be made take in photograph.
